WebHold an ice pack over the bruise to reduce any swelling. A frozen bag of peas wrapped in a tea towel makes a good ice pack. Do not put ice directly on the skin. (The bag of peas can be repeatedly re-frozen but don’t eat the re-frozen peas.) The swelling should go down quickly, leaving just the bruising. Web6 okt. 2024 · Apply a cold compress to the affected area to reduce the swelling. Note: Do not put ice directly on the skin. Cold compresses can be applied for 30–60 minutes a day until the bruising subsides. If the bruise is on an extremity (eg, arm or leg), raise it above the heart to reduce the flow of blood to the affected area. Most bruises are relatively minor and will get better on their own in about 10 days. If the bruise is quite large and swollen, apply an ice pack to reduce swelling and relieve pain.
